POLICE LOOK INTO DEATH OF MIDDLE SCHOOL TEACHER

Thirty-year old Angelique Shores was laid to rest this morning, three days after losing her life around the corner from where she taught. Police say Shores was headed west on West Pleasure Friday afternoon when a car ran the stop sign at South Sowell and slammed into her. Shores` car hit a house and then flipped onto it`s top. While Shores did not survive the wreck, her 5 year old daughter did....strapped into her car seat on the one part of the car that didn`t flatten. According to officers, the 18-year-old- driver of the other car, Tristan Chatman, was behind the wheel of a Honda filled with alcohol. Since Chatman was injured during the wreck, officers were not able to give him a breathalizer test at the scene. A blood sample was taken from him at the hospital instead. That sample has been sent to the state health department for alcohol analysis.
